Abstract
In this paper, practical yet accurate formulae are proposed to predict the structural damage of rectangular unstiffened and stiffened plates under explosion loads. The numerical computation method adopted in this study was validated using published test data and then, rigorous parametric studies were conducted for various plate models. Regression analyses of the parametric study results were performed to derive design formulae, which produced linear relationships between the residual damages of plates and an impact parameter. These formulae have been compared with existing ones and it is confirmed that the proposed ones are more accurate and simpler than others.
